Family and friends must say goodbye to their beloved Ralph Carmichael Sr. of Atlanta, Georgia, born in Mobile, Alabama, who passed away at the age of 66, on April 15, 2021. He was predeceased by : his parents, Mattie Carmichael and John Carmichael; his aunts and uncles, W. C. Carter, Odell Carter, Martha Hill and Myrtle Turner (late Preston Turner); and his great grandchild Otis Fralin.
He is survived by : his daughters, Shiquitha Boykin, Erin Rembert (Bobby) and Courtney Carmichael; his wife Angelitta Carmichael; his son Ralph Charles Carmichael, II; his grandchildren, Daniel Rembert, Ava Rembert, Marvin Peters, Jasmine Peters, Joshua Peters, Melissa Demetrii Perry, Kaeylan Perry and Michael Fralin; and his aunts and uncles, Willie Mae Johnson (late Oscar), Ethel Mae (late Silas) of Washington, Clara Barnes (late Eddie), Gladys Daniels (Arthella), Lloyd Carter, James Carter (Kathryn), Roy Lee Carter (DeLois) and Samuel Carter.
